You don’t go to the Birdwatcher’s General Store in Orleans, MA just for birdseed, feeders, and the like, though the humble location does have just about anything you might need in that category. Chock-a-block full of bird books, binoculars, clothing, jewelry, CDs, videos, works by local artists, ornaments, carvings, and the omnipresent seed offerings, the store is a haven for avid birders and backyard feeder junkies alike. If you’re lucky, the owner will be on hand the day you visit. He’s a character and a half, so be prepared. Actually you’ll start to get the idea behind this whimsical bird store from the signs out front announcing the daily hours (Mon.-Sat. 9:03 – 5:57, Sun. 10:13 – 5:29) and the number of days left until “Free Hat Full of Potatoes” Day.

Mike O’Connor opened the store in 1983 and has happily been answering bird questions ever since. He writes the popular column “Ask the Bird Folks” for the Cape Codder newspaper and has penned two tomes on birding aptly named “Why Don’t Woodpeckers Get Headaches” and “Why Do Bluebirds Hate Me”.

My husband loves this store and always stops to watch the streaming video of the Droll Yankee Flip Feeder that literally spins under the weight of a squirrel and flips it off the feeder into mid-air. Personally I love the bathroom. The walls are covered with cartoons, photos, signs, and posters that never fail to make me (or anyone else reading them there) laugh out loud. When was the last time you did that in a public bathroom?
